The South Korean and US military authorities fired a combined surface-to-surface missile into the East Sea in response to North Korea's interim-range ballistic missile (IRBM) provocation today (5th), the Joint Chiefs of Staff said.



In this combined surface-to-surface missile firing, the South Korean military and USFK fired a total of four ATACMS two rounds each into the East Sea, demonstrating the combined force's ability to precisely strike virtual targets and deter further provocations, the Joint Chiefs of Staff. explained.



The Joint Chiefs of Staff emphasized, "North Korea has maintained its watchdog posture no matter where it provokes, demonstrating that it has the capability and readiness to neutralize the origin of the provocation."



In preparation for further North Korean provocations, the South Korean military is tracking and monitoring related trends and maintaining a full readiness posture to guarantee an overwhelming victory at all times, he said.
